I originally hadn't wanted to read this because I was convinced that it was going to be another cliché 'girl acts casual, prince falls in love with her' kind of story.
I'm so happy I finally picked it up though.
Kiera Cass's writing style is gorgeous and captivating. My heart was beating in my chest the entire time!
But - the love triangle
Seriously, I can't feel any Chemistry between Aspen and America, and I tried. I'm going to be extremely upset if she lets her feelings for Aspen get in the way of her happily ever after with Maxon! The kingdom needs someone like her, not like that awful girl Celeste.

A thing I found extremely exciting was the rebel attacks. I really want to learn more about these Southerners and Northerners! I have a feeling I'll see a lot more of them in the next books though. Everything will probably escalate.

And last but not least I loved her family! They were all so real and well-developed! May was my absolute favourite, of course. She was just a bundle of joy.
